OWENSBORO, Ky. (WEHT) -- Recent reports by the Kentucky Office of Drug Control Policy show fentanyl involved in over 70 percent of overdose deaths in the state. "The fentanyl on the streets [is] currently 100 times more potent than morphine. Most of the time they're pressed pills so you don't really know how much you're getting that makes it more dangerous.
